Writing this post is quite like a tribute to Hans Restaurant (otherwise known as Al Reem Cafe) which serves the most authentic (so far) Malaysian dishes in Abu Dhabi. It is not too long since I learned about it from a Malaysian blogger and since then I have been consistently taking lunch there every Saturday.
Hans Restaurant is specifically located inside Tamouh’s office (a construction company). It is cafeteria-like and originally intended to cater to its employees only. It was a generous decision to open it to outsiders like me who long for a real taste of Malaysian food without the need to re-visit or travel to Malaysia or its neighbouring countries.
